What side effects might I experience with Ketamine Therapy?

Back to FAQs

Ketamine Therapy is regarded as safe and effective when delivered by qualified medical providers. However, as with any medical treatment, certain risks and potential side effects exist.

Common side effects include:

  • Dissociation (feeling disconnected from one’s body)
  • Dizziness, lightheadedness, and headache
  • Nausea and vomiting
  • Blurred vision
  • Pain or discomfort at the IV site
  • Feeling temporarily unbalanced or uncoordinated
  • Elevated heart rate and increased blood pressure
  • Vivid dreams that feel realistic

If you’re prone to nausea or motion sickness, inform your provider so they can include anti-nausea medication with your IV Ketamine treatment.

Most common side effects resolve approximately 15 minutes after the IV infusion concludes.

While rare, more serious side effects include:

  • Low mood or suicidal thoughts
  • Allergic reaction
  • Low blood pressure
  • Slowed heartrate
  • Bladder inflammation
  • Delirium

Discuss any concerns with your provider prior to receiving an IV treatment.
